I Have reset a users domain password in active directory users / My Business / Users.

I can now log on to the users PC, but I can't get access to the server shares.
Do I have to reset something somewhere?

I don't understand why this has happened, I have reset passwords before with no problem.

Any Ideas?

Do you have more than one domain controller? It may have something to do with replication.

Double check the shares, make sure the user has permissions to access them, some how he may have been removed.
